Note
"The Pamir Mountains are a mountain range in Central Asia, at the junction of the Himalayas with the Tian Shan, Karakoram, Kunlun, Hindu Kush, Suleman and Hindu Raj ranges. They are among the world´s highest mountains.

The Pamir Mountains lie mostly in the Gorno-Badakhshan province of Tajikistan. To the north, they join the Tian Shan mountains along the Alay Valley of Kyrgyzstan. To the south, they border the Hindu Kush mountains along Afghanistan´s Wakhan Corridor. To the east, they extend to the range that includes China´s Kongur Tagh, in the "Eastern Pamirs", separated by the Yarkand valley from the Kunlun Mountains." - (en.wikipedia.org 07.02.2020)
